Transaction 01ba2c5363f386a27eef46eb95a6ce589c054c20829fe9bec62eef18552fce31
1 Input
1 Output
-
01ba2c5363f386a27eef46eb95a6ce589c054c20829fe9bec62eef18552fce31:0
- value
- 20974696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81c022aabbf8445ec4cfb930acfbcad0247cf5ce OP_EQUAL
- address
- 3DX5G6LDq82dx2USCb3LCTwmuxN55kKrjb